Elegant Courtesans in Japanese Art

Japanese woodblock prints depict elegant courtesans in traditional attire, showcasing intricate patterns and soft colors, along with intimate moments and cultural themes.

Three women and a boy among lanterns, Through an open window with four lanterns, a view of a room with two women, standing, talking to a seated third woman, in the background a boy, pointing to the side., Kitao Masanobu (attributed to), Japan, 1780 - 1785, paper, colour woodcut, h 387 mm × w 262 mm
